Steam Api Init Download Work Jun 2026

Title: Automated Game Content Acquisition via Steam Interfaces

This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.

In this post, we'll walk you through the process of initializing and downloading the Steam API. We'll cover the necessary steps, provide code examples, and offer troubleshooting tips to ensure a smooth experience. steam api init download

Right-click your and select Properties . Navigate to the Compatibility tab.

The Steamworks API will not initialize unless it knows the of your game. When a player launches your game through the Steam launcher, this ID is provided automatically. However, when you are developing or testing your game in an IDE, Steam is not explicitly launching the process. Can’t copy the link right now

Repeat these exact steps for the executable ( .exe ) file of the specific game causing the error. 3. Verify Integrity of Game Files

HttpResponse<String> enumerateResponse = client.send(enumerateRequest, HttpResponse.BodyHandlers.ofString()); We'll cover the necessary steps, provide code examples,

: Steam may have missed or corrupted a steam_api.dll file during a previous download. Right-click the game in your Library > Properties > Installed Files > Verify integrity of game files .

Right-click your (or the Steam.exe file in your installation directory) and select Properties . Navigate to the Compatibility tab.

Launch the game directly from your instead of a desktop shortcut. 2. Standardize Administrator Privileges

The Steam API init download process typically involves the following steps: